Frequently Asked Questions:
- How much sunlight does the Euphorbia Milii need? This plant thrives in full sun or mostly sunny locations. Aim for at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day.
- What kind of soil is best for my Crown of Thorns? Use a well-draining cactus or succulent potting mix. This will prevent root rot.
- How often should I water my Euphorbia Milii? Water thoroughly when the soil is dry to the touch. Allow the soil to dry out completely between waterings. Overwatering can be detrimental.
- Is the Crown of Thorns plant poisonous? Yes, the sap of the Euphorbia Milii can be irritating to the skin and toxic if ingested. Keep away from children and pets and wash your hands after handling.
